                  Originally posted by Pullcounter View Post
                  s-mart gotta use his legs and head movement to beat pwill.
                  If the last fight showed anything it's that if Martinez "fights" him even though he lands the harder punches and inflicts more damage, larglely thanks to his crisp skilled counterpunching (any PW's inaccuracy), the judges are likely to score rounds for PW's pitty pat and missed shots simply due to punches throw.

                  Martinez needs to use his legs and movement which he has the ability to do just like Quintana did in their first fight which limited PW's punch output to around 50 ppr. If he stands in front of him PW will win rounds simply for flailing his arms.
